Electric control valves are instrumental in controlling the flow of liquid, gas, and steam during industrial processes. They are manufactured to achieve very precise control over pressure, temperature, and flow by employing electric actuators. Electric control valves are in higher demand because they are capable of enhancing automation, efficiency, and plant safety during the operation of oil and gas, power plants, water treatment plants, and chemical plants.

3-Way Control Valve:
A 3-way control valve is a general-purpose electric control valve employed to mix or divert flow in a piping system. It contains three ports – one inlet and two outlets (or vice versa) – which enable it to control the direction and mixing of flow. The valves are widely applied in HVAC systems, water treatment plants, and chemical processing plants.
Two typical types of 3-way control valves exist:
Mixing Type: Merges two inlet flows into an outlet flow.
Diverting Type: Steers one inlet flow into either of two paths of outlets.
3-way control valves allow versatility and enhanced management of complicated flow processes.
Functions of Electric Control Valves:
Flow Regulation: Regulates a constant flow rate regardless of pressure conditions.
Pressure Control: Prevents overpressure situations by modulating valve opening.
Temperature Control: Regulates flow rate in order to sustain set process temperatures.
Automated Shutdown: Automatically closes the valve in event of system failure or emergency.
Advantages of Electric Control Valves:
Precise Control: Provides accurate regulation of flow, pressure, and temperature.
Remote Operation: Can be programmed to be driven from a central control room for added safety and efficiency.
Economical Energy Consumption: Reduces energy consumption through efficient flow regulation.
Quick Response: The electric actuators react quickly and facilitate quick changes.
Less Maintenance: With fewer mechanical components, there is less wear and tear, and therefore, reduced maintenance costs.
Components:
Valve Body: Encases the interior components and gives structural support.
Actuator: An electric motor used for opening and closing the valve in response to control signals.
Stem: Link between the actuator and the plug or disc.
Plug or Disc: Controls the flow by opening or shutting the valve port.
Positioner: Provides precise positioning of the valve according to control input.
Seals and Linings: Avoids leakage and tight shut-off.
Types of Electric Control Valves:
Globe Control Valve: Specially suited for accurate flow control in high-temperature and high-pressure services.
Butterfly Control Valve: Best suited for high flow rates with low pressure drop.
Ball Control Valve: Offers rapid shut-off and smooth flow control.
3-Way Control Valve: Employed in mixing and diverting the flow in sophisticated systems.
Angle Control Valve: Suitable for handling abrasive and high-velocity fluids.
Electric control valves are used to control the flow of fluids automatically through electric actuators. The actuator is signalled by a control system and changes the valve opening to keep the desired flow rate, pressure, and temperature. Electric control valves come in a range of materials such as stainless steel, cast iron, and alloy steel to suit different operating conditions.
